Easy to maintain

It is essential to maintain your Krups Nespresso machine to get the most delicious cup of espresso. Regular cleaning and descaling will prolong the longevity of your machine as well as increase the performance. These simple steps will ensure that you enjoy your Nespresso machine for many years to come.

Cleaning the removable parts is the first step towards maintaining your Nespresso. Clean the water tank as well as the drip tray with warm soapy water, and then rinse thoroughly. Clean the capsule container and the drip tray, too, Nespresso krups machine to prevent any residue buildup. After cleaning you can wipe the exterior of the machine down with a damp rag.

The next step is to prepare the solution you will use to remove the scale from your machine. There are numerous commercial descaling products available that are specifically made specifically for Nespresso machines, but you can also use white vinegar. White vinegar should not be consumed in large quantities because it can damage your machine's pipes. You should instead opt for an descaling product that is pre-dosed for your machine.

After you've prepared the descaling solution, make sure to follow the instructions in the Nespresso machine's manual, or the instructions on the package. Also, you should put a container underneath the coffee outlet to catch the solution as it drains out from the machine. Depending on the machine, you might need to run an descaling procedure every month or three times per year.

It is important to clean your Krups Nespresso machine regularly, since it can cause problems such as clogging and poor flavor. Cleaning and descaling the machine will help reduce accumulation of limescale and minerals, which can affect your coffee's quality. Descale your machine every three months, or after 300 capsules, depending on what happens first. You can also clean your milk system and brewgroup every day.
